<dcvalue element="description" qualifier="abstract">Single-layered&#x20;graphenes&#x20;with&#x20;large&#x20;sizes&#x20;were&#x20;produced&#x20;by&#x20;inserting&#x20;solvent&#x20;molecules&#x20;between&#x20;the&#x20;graphene&#x20;layers&#x20;in&#x20;graphite&#x20;intercalation&#x20;compounds&#x20;(GICs)&#x20;followed&#x20;by&#x20;direct&#x20;microwave&#x20;exfoliation&#x20;&amp;apos;in&#x20;a&#x20;solvent&amp;apos;&#x20;to&#x20;prevent&#x20;re-aggregation.&#x20;During&#x20;the&#x20;microwave&#x20;exfoliation&#x20;of&#x20;GICs&#x20;in&#x20;deionized&#x20;(DI)&#x20;water,&#x20;single-layered&#x20;graphenes&#x20;were&#x20;produced,&#x20;and&#x20;their&#x20;lateral&#x20;sizes&#x20;ranged&#x20;from&#x20;several&#x20;micrometers&#x20;to&#x20;several&#x20;tens&#x20;of&#x20;micrometers.&#x20;The&#x20;entire&#x20;process&#x20;time&#x20;was&#x20;less&#x20;than&#x20;2&#x20;h,&#x20;and&#x20;toxic&#x20;compounds&#x20;were&#x20;not&#x20;used.&#x20;In&#x20;the&#x20;case&#x20;of&#x20;microwave&#x20;exfoliation&#x20;in&#x20;acetone&#x20;or&#x20;ethanol,&#x20;graphenes&#x20;with&#x20;a&#x20;thickness&#x20;of&#x20;3-6nm&#x20;were&#x20;mainly&#x20;produced&#x20;rather&#x20;than&#x20;single-layered&#x20;graphenes.&#x20;In&#x20;addition,&#x20;when&#x20;the&#x20;produced&#x20;graphenes&#x20;were&#x20;directly&#x20;dispersed&#x20;in&#x20;DI&#x20;water,&#x20;the&#x20;dispersed&#x20;state&#x20;was&#x20;maintained&#x20;for&#x20;2&#x20;days.&#x20;This&#x20;method&#x20;is&#x20;very&#x20;advantageous&#x20;for&#x20;industrial&#x20;scale-up.&#x20;(C)&#x20;2018&#x20;Elsevier&#x20;Ltd.&#x20;All&#x20;rights&#x20;reserved.</dcvalue>
